BUDGET: Pensions to increase in 2022

Rises in state pension amount, Child Benefit and Carer's Allowance

Around 19,000 pensioners on the Isle of Man will see their pension rise by 3.1 per cent this year.

The basic state pension, additional pension and Manx State Pension are all being increased.

Those claiming the Manx State Pension will receive £202.23 per week – up from £196.14.

Around 3,000 individuals and families who are on low incomes will also benefit from a rise in Income Support and Jobseeker's Allowance - Child Benefit is also going up by five per cent.

Disability allowances are also up – with Carer's Allowance increasing by 15 per cent; something that is set to benefit around 550 Manx caregivers.

Benefits: 

  • Basic state pension, additional pension, Manx State Pension will all rise by 3.1 per cent
  • Child Benefit and Employed Person's Allowance will both increase by 5 per cent
  • Carer's Allowance will rise by 15 per cent
  • Attendance Allowance, Disability Living Allowance and Income Support for disability and disabled child premiums will rise by five per cent
  • Income Support Carer Premium to increase by 26.4 per cent
  • Nursing Care Contribution to increase by 3.1 per cent
